namespace WebCore {
void TextTrackCueMap::add(GenericCueData* cueData, TextTrackCueGeneric* cue)
{
m_dataToCueMap.add(cueData, cue);
m_cueToDataMap.add(cue, cueData);
}
PassRefPtr<TextTrackCueGeneric> TextTrackCueMap::find(GenericCueData* cueData)
{
GenericCueDataToCueMap::iterator iter = m_dataToCueMap.find(cueData);
if (iter == m_dataToCueMap.end())
return 0;
return iter->value;
}
PassRefPtr<GenericCueData> TextTrackCueMap::find(TextTrackCueGeneric* cue)
{
GenericCueToCueDataMap::iterator iter = m_cueToDataMap.find(cue);
if (iter == m_cueToDataMap.end())
return 0;
return iter->value;
}
void TextTrackCueMap::remove(GenericCueData* cueData)
{
RefPtr<TextTrackCueGeneric> cue = find(cueData);
if (cue)
m_cueToDataMap.remove(cue);
m_dataToCueMap.remove(cueData);
}
void TextTrackCueMap::remove(TextTrackCueGeneric* cue)
{
RefPtr<GenericCueData> cueData = find(cue);
if (cueData)
m_dataToCueMap.remove(cueData);
m_cueToDataMap.remove(cue);
}
PassRefPtr<InbandTextTrack> InbandTextTrack::create(ScriptExecutionContext* context, TextTrackClient* client, PassRefPtr<InbandTextTrackPrivate> playerPrivate)
{
return adoptRef(new InbandTextTrack(context, client, playerPrivate));
}
InbandTextTrack::InbandTextTrack(ScriptExecutionContext* context, TextTrackClient* client, PassRefPtr<InbandTextTrackPrivate> tracksPrivate)
: TextTrack(context, client, emptyString(), tracksPrivate->label(), tracksPrivate->language(), InBand)
, m_private(tracksPrivate)
{
m_private->setClient(this);
switch (m_private->kind()) {
case InbandTextTrackPrivate::Subtitles:
setKind(TextTrack::subtitlesKeyword());
break;
case InbandTextTrackPrivate::Captions:
setKind(TextTrack::captionsKeyword());
break;
case InbandTextTrackPrivate::Descriptions:
setKind(TextTrack::descriptionsKeyword());
break;
case InbandTextTrackPrivate::Chapters:
setKind(TextTrack::chaptersKeyword());
break;
case InbandTextTrackPrivate::Metadata:
setKind(TextTrack::metadataKeyword());
break;
case InbandTextTrackPrivate::Forced:
setKind(TextTrack::forcedKeyword());
break;
case InbandTextTrackPrivate::None:
default:
ASSERT_NOT_REACHED();
break;
}
}
InbandTextTrack::~InbandTextTrack()
{
m_private->setClient(0);
}
void InbandTextTrack::setMode(const AtomicString& mode)
{
TextTrack::setMode(mode);
if (mode == TextTrack::disabledKeyword())
m_private->setMode(InbandTextTrackPrivate::Disabled);
else if (mode == TextTrack::hiddenKeyword())
m_private->setMode(InbandTextTrackPrivate::Hidden);
else if (mode == TextTrack::showingKeyword())
m_private->setMode(InbandTextTrackPrivate::Showing);
else
ASSERT_NOT_REACHED();
}
bool InbandTextTrack::isClosedCaptions() const
{
if (!m_private)
return false;
return m_private->isClosedCaptions();
}
bool InbandTextTrack::isSDH() const
{
if (!m_private)
return false;
return m_private->isSDH();
}
bool InbandTextTrack::containsOnlyForcedSubtitles() const
{
if (!m_private)
return false;
return m_private->containsOnlyForcedSubtitles();
}
bool InbandTextTrack::isMainProgramContent() const
{
if (!m_private)
return false;
return m_private->isMainProgramContent();
}
bool InbandTextTrack::isEasyToRead() const
{
if (!m_private)
return false;
return m_private->isEasyToRead();
}
size_t InbandTextTrack::inbandTrackIndex()
{
ASSERT(m_private);
return m_private->textTrackIndex();
}
void InbandTextTrack::updateCueFromCueData(TextTrackCueGeneric* cue, GenericCueData* cueData)
{
cue->willChange();
cue->setStartTime(cueData->startTime(), IGNORE_EXCEPTION);
double endTime = cueData->endTime();
if (std::isinf(endTime) && mediaElement())
endTime = mediaElement()->duration();
cue->setEndTime(endTime, IGNORE_EXCEPTION);
cue->setText(cueData->content());
cue->setId(cueData->id());
cue->setBaseFontSizeRelativeToVideoHeight(cueData->baseFontSize());
cue->setFontSizeMultiplier(cueData->relativeFontSize());
cue->setFontName(cueData->fontName());
if (cueData->position() > 0)
cue->setPosition(lround(cueData->position()), IGNORE_EXCEPTION);
if (cueData->line() > 0)
cue->setLine(lround(cueData->line()), IGNORE_EXCEPTION);
if (cueData->size() > 0)
cue->setSize(lround(cueData->size()), IGNORE_EXCEPTION);
if (cueData->backgroundColor().isValid())
cue->setBackgroundColor(cueData->backgroundColor().rgb());
if (cueData->foregroundColor().isValid())
cue->setForegroundColor(cueData->foregroundColor().rgb());
if (cueData->highlightColor().isValid())
cue->setHighlightColor(cueData->highlightColor().rgb());
if (cueData->align() == GenericCueData::Start)
cue->setAlign(ASCIILiteral("start"), IGNORE_EXCEPTION);
else if (cueData->align() == GenericCueData::Middle)
cue->setAlign(ASCIILiteral("middle"), IGNORE_EXCEPTION);
else if (cueData->align() == GenericCueData::End)
cue->setAlign(ASCIILiteral("end"), IGNORE_EXCEPTION);
cue->setSnapToLines(false);
cue->didChange();
}
void InbandTextTrack::addGenericCue(InbandTextTrackPrivate* trackPrivate, PassRefPtr<GenericCueData> prpCueData)
{
UNUSED_PARAM(trackPrivate);
ASSERT(trackPrivate == m_private);
RefPtr<GenericCueData> cueData = prpCueData;
if (m_cueMap.find(cueData.get()))
return;
RefPtr<TextTrackCueGeneric> cue = TextTrackCueGeneric::create(scriptExecutionContext(), cueData->startTime(), cueData->endTime(), cueData->content());
updateCueFromCueData(cue.get(), cueData.get());
if (hasCue(cue.get(), TextTrackCue::IgnoreDuration)) {
LOG(Media, "InbandTextTrack::addGenericCue ignoring already added cue: start=%.2f, end=%.2f, content=\"%s\"\n", cueData->startTime(), cueData->endTime(), cueData->content().utf8().data());
return;
}
if (cueData->status() != GenericCueData::Complete)
m_cueMap.add(cueData.get(), cue.get());
addCue(cue);
}
void InbandTextTrack::updateGenericCue(InbandTextTrackPrivate*, GenericCueData* cueData)
{
RefPtr<TextTrackCueGeneric> cue = m_cueMap.find(cueData);
if (!cue)
return;
updateCueFromCueData(cue.get(), cueData);
if (cueData->status() == GenericCueData::Complete)
m_cueMap.remove(cueData);
}
void InbandTextTrack::removeGenericCue(InbandTextTrackPrivate*, GenericCueData* cueData)
{
RefPtr<TextTrackCueGeneric> cue = m_cueMap.find(cueData);
if (cue) {
LOG(Media, "InbandTextTrack::removeGenericCue removing cue: start=%.2f, end=%.2f, content=\"%s\"\n", cueData->startTime(), cueData->endTime(), cueData->content().utf8().data());
removeCue(cue.get(), IGNORE_EXCEPTION);
} else
m_cueMap.remove(cueData);
}
void InbandTextTrack::removeCue(TextTrackCue* cue, ExceptionCode& ec)
{
m_cueMap.remove(static_cast<TextTrackCueGeneric*>(cue));
TextTrack::removeCue(cue, ec);
}
void InbandTextTrack::willRemoveTextTrackPrivate(InbandTextTrackPrivate* trackPrivate)
{
if (!mediaElement())
return;
UNUSED_PARAM(trackPrivate);
ASSERT(trackPrivate == m_private);
mediaElement()->removeTextTrack(this);
}
}
